excel里开方的函数?除了SQRT还有IMSQRT支持复数开方
在Excel中,进行开方运算的函数主要有两个:`SQRT` 和 `IMSQRT`。这两个函数分别用于处理实数和复数的开方运算,各自具有特定的应用场景和功能。
SQRT 函数
`SQRT` 函数是Excel中常用的开方函数,用于计算一个非负实数的平方根。其语法非常简单,只有一个参数:
excel
SQRT(number)
其中,`number` 是需要开方的非负实数。如果输入的参数是负数,Excel会返回一个错误值 `NUM!`,因为实数的平方根在实数范围内是无意义的。
示例
假设单元格A1中存储了数字16,可以在另一个单元格中输入以下公式来计算其平方根:
excel
=SQRT(A1)
这将返回结果4,因为4的平方等于16。
应用场景
`SQRT` 函数在许多实际应用中非常有用,例如:
1. 科学计算:在物理、化学等科学领域,经常需要计算各种量的平方根。
2. 统计分析:在统计学中,标准差、方差等指标的计算都涉及到平方根。
3. 工程设计:在工程设计中,许多参数的计算也需要用到平方根。
IMSQRT 函数
与 `SQRT` 函数不同,`IMSQRT` 函数专门用于计算复数的平方根。复数是由实部和虚部组成的数,通常表示为 `a + bi`,其中 `a` 和 `b` 是实数,`i` 是虚数单位。`IMSQRT` 函数的语法如下:
excel
IMSQRT(inumber)
其中,`inumber` 是一个复数,可以是以下几种形式:
- `"a+bi"`:例如 `"3+4i"`。
- `"a+bj"`:例如 `"3+4j"`。
- `"a+bmi"`:例如 `"3+4mi"`。
示例
假设单元格A1中存储了复数 `3+4i`,可以在另一个单元格中输入以下公式来计算其平方根:
excel
=IMSQRT(A1)
这将返回结果 `2+1i`,因为 `(2+1i)^2 = 3+4i`。
应用场景
`IMSQRT` 函数在处理复数运算时非常有用,例如:
1. 信号处理:在信号处理中,复数常用于表示信号的幅度和相位。
2. 控制理论:在控制理论中,系统的稳定性分析经常涉及到复数的运算。
3. 量子力学:在量子力学中,波函数的描述和计算经常使用复数。
Excel中的开方函数 `SQRT` 和 `IMSQRT` 分别适用于实数和复数的开方运算。`SQRT` 函数简单易用,适用于大多数实数开方需求;而 `IMSQRT` 函数则专门用于处理复数的开方,适用于需要复数运算的特定领域。通过合理使用这两个函数,可以高效地完成各种开方运算任务。
